In a similar vein, as a non-American I'd say the biggest reason for people outside of America to hate it is because of what America claims to be, but isn't. And this perceived hypocrisy and arrogance is something that goes beyond any administration (although it's influenced by it, strongly so in the case of Bush), it's the absolute belief by many Americans that these claims are true even if refuted by reality, and this is the attitude that the media broadcasts to the outside world.

Even when there is a discussion of all the things that are wrong, there's still this attitude of "As crap as we may be, we're still better than any other country by default. God loves America." that isn't very appealling to non-Americans.
